1. A lubricating composition comprising:
a majority of one or more base oils of lubricating viscosity;
an organometallic phosphorus-providing antiwear additive or salt thereof made by a process comprising the steps of (a) reacting an organic hydroxy compound with phosphorus pentasulfide to form a reaction product; (b) distilling the reaction product and recovering a condensate; and (c) neutralizing the condensate with a basic or neutral metal compound including one or more of a metal oxide, a metal hydroxide, or a metal carbonate to form the organometallic phosphorus-providing antiwear additive or salt thereof.
